I just received some information on this single board computer. 4Mhz Z-80, 128k ram (2 banks of 64k), built in video, and boot EPROM (video RAM and EPROM are in 3rd bank), 2 serial ports [SIO], CTC, ~4 parallel ports (keyboard and Centronics printer) [8255 and PIO], floppy controller (5.25 and 8") [WD1793], clock chip with battery; comes complete with CP/M 3.0. It costs about $600 singly, drops to $450 in large quantites. They claim their BIOS can run any combination of 5.25 and 8" drives (4 total). It looks like a good basis for a portable 8-bit CP/M system (the board is a bit larger than a 5.25" drive). Has anyone ever seen one, comments/criticisms? Words of advice?
